"This APA location was shiny, new and nice all over. My biggest complaint about the stay was with the city and its sidewalks. Read on if you're interested! **Positives: *Various signs of of the hotel being fancy and nice: Slick lights on the keycard scanners, near-silent elevators...and that's all that comes to mind atm. *Hot coffee in the vending machine! That was a nice change of pace, after a week in Aomori where I had to go into a conbini to get a couple cans of hot coffee after meals. *Room was all-around "pretty darn comfortable." *AC was a standout -- unlike AC that you have to adjust every time you notice it's either too hot or too humid in the room, this AC kept the temperature even and super-comfortable, late-July. It even emitted a very relaxing windy sound. **Neutral: * I didn't do laundry, so I didn't notice how expensive it was. **Negatives: *Yikes, the noise. *A ~20min walk from the station to the hotel, with no tram. There might be busses from the station to the hotel; I didn't check. *During that 20min walk to/from the station (and another stroll on another day), I looked for a path that had sidewalk all the way from the station to the hotel (checking the 3 routes in Google Maps); I didn't find one. Not at ALL convenient, when you have a suitcase in tow. You can follow sidewalk from the station to a 7-11 parking lot not far away, cut across it and return to sidewalk...but that's apparently the best you can do, atm. Develop that city please, Hachinohe."

"This was an amazing experience, staying in a renovated samurai home. I stayed in the larger suite and had a full view of the garden and a lanterned alcove just outside the bath. Everything is new and clean, and the owners clearly take pride in this historic home. Even the tatami seams are artful. The staff was so friendly. I only speak a little Japanese, but they were patient and kind while I thought of the right words, and check-in was lovely. They also held my bag while I went sightseeing. It was so quiet at night that I slept very well. I didn't hear anything from the restaurant, just the occasional road noise, but it wasn't a bother at all. The traditional futon was cozy! I would absolutely stay here again, especially if I returned with a group because it's a rare 2-bedroom (4 futons) and very spacious."
